Apple News

Apple påminner utvecklare om att Safari 14 stöder tillägg portade från Chrome, Firefox och Edge

Fredagen den 28 augusti 2020 09:42 PDT av Joe Rossignol

Apple den här veckan påminde utvecklarna att de kan skapa webbtillägg i Safari 14 med samma WebExtensions API som används i andra webbläsare, som Chrome, Firefox och Edge. Ett nytt konverteringsverktyg i Xcode 12 beta tillåter också utvecklare att porta befintliga tillägg från andra webbläsare till Safari och göra tillgängliga på Mac App Store senare i år.





när tillverkades iphone se

safari macos ikon banner
Apple säger att utvecklare har två alternativ för att skapa Safari-webbtillägg:

• Konvertera ditt befintliga tillägg till ett Safari-webbtillägg, så att du kan använda det i Safari på macOS och distribuera det i App Store. Xcode innehåller ett kommandoradsverktyg för att förenkla denna process.
• Bygg ett nytt Safari-webbtillägg i Xcode med den inbyggda mallen. Du kan sedan paketera om tilläggsfilerna för distribution i andra webbläsare.



Safari-webbtillägg är tillgängliga i macOS Big Sur och i macOS 10.14.6 eller 10.15.6 med Safari 14 installerat.

Alla Chrome-, Firefox- och Edge-tillägg kommer inte att fungera i Safari, och utvecklare kommer att behöva betala 99 USD per år för ett Apple Developer Program-medlemskap för att portera sina tillägg till Safari. Apple har en WWDC video och dokumentation med mer information för utvecklare.